Ray Vaughn Denslow (1885–1960)[1] was an author, poet, and historian of Freemasonry. Ray was noted for many different pieces of writing including that of I Am Freemasonry.[2] His other books include A Handbook for Royal Arch Masons,[3] Masonic Rites and Degrees,[4] The Masonic World,[5] and Freemasonry in the Western Hemisphere.[6] Ray was a former Grand Master of the Grand Lodge of Missouri.[7]
